Class: Slack::Messages::Field

Inherits:
Object
  • Object
show all
Defined in:
lib/slack/messages/field.rb

Constant Summary collapse

FIELD_PARAMS =
i[
  title
  value
  short
].freeze

Instance Method Summary collapse

Instance Method Details

#to_paramsObject



12
13
14
15
16
17
18
# File 'lib/slack/messages/field.rb', line 12

def to_params
  params = {}
  FIELD_PARAMS.each { |p|
    params["#{p}"] = send(p) unless send(p).nil?
  }
  params
end